With experience on Wall Street and Bay Street, Alex brings a wealth of unique advocacy experience for clients.

Alex is an associate in the firm’s Labour & Employment Group in Toronto. He advises clients in workplace law matters including employment standards, wrongful dismissals, human rights, privacy, workplace investigations, occupational health and safety, collective bargaining, labour arbitrations and labour and employment issues arising in corporate transactions.

Alex began his career as a summer student, articling student, and later as a Labour and Employment Associate at McCarthy Tétrault before moving to New York City to practice as a commercial litigator at a renowned global law firm. Alex has represented clients in the Ontario Superior Court of Justice, the Ontario Human Rights Tribunal, the Ontario Labour Relations Board, the Canada Industrial Relations Board, the Federal Court, the Federal Court of Appeal and numerous U.S. state, federal and appellate courts. In addition to labour and employment matters, Alex has represented clients in a wide range of complex civil litigation and investigatory matters, including securities, environmental tort, bankruptcy, and products liability class actions.

Alex received his Bachelor of Arts (Honours) in History and Political Science from the University of Toronto. He received a Dual Canadian and American law degree from the University of Windsor and University of Detroit Mercy, graduating at the top of his class. In law school, Alex was the recipient of numerous scholarships and awards and was selected to give the Valedictorian address to his graduating class.

Alex is a member of the firm’s Inclusion Now initiative, including as a member of the Pride Action Group, which is committed to advancing LGBTQ2S initiatives in the firm, with our clients, and beyond.

Alex is also a Sessional Instructor at the University of Windsor’s Faculty of Law, teaching a course to law students regarding Labour Arbitration.

Alex is a member of the Ontario Bar Association’s Labour and Employment Section Executive for the 2023-2024 term.

Alex is admitted to practice in Ontario, New York, and the United States District Court of the Southern District of New York.

He is a member of the Law Society of Ontario, the Ontario Bar Association, the Human Resources Professional Association, the American Bar Association, New York State Bar Association, and New York City Bar Association.
